Canzano torches Scott, Pac-12 hierarchy

Discussion in 'Sports and News' started by ChrisLong, Nov 29, 2018.

  1. ChrisLong

    ChrisLong Well-Known Member

    Outstanding Portland Oregonian columnist John Canzano writes an investigative story on Pac-12 commissioner Larry Scott, his failed plans and his extravagant lifestyle, all on the conferences money. Several comparisons to the SEC and Big Ten. It is 4 parts. Here is Part 1. There is a link in Part 1 to Part 2, which is about the lawyer stepping in to change calls from the video replay room. Part 3 is supposed to be today, and, presumably, Part 4 tomorrow.
